Output ea8f33aab5f64cbe159b6f4a13ce5265f147f061a15906a2142b1e7250ebf8d4:5

value
789235
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 431466e7222d3526afac0740eb2985d01f0e2eca OP_EQUALVERIFY OP_CHECKSIG
address
177giQYgfsw99bCGjFALvC2nLNWAegMpdi
transaction
ea8f33aab5f64cbe159b6f4a13ce5265f147f061a15906a2142b1e7250ebf8d4
confirmations
516286
spent
true